Compartir a través de


Tarea 5: Modificar el destino de OLE DB

Anteriormente, en la lección 2, ha actualizado la instrucción SQL en la tarea Ejecutar SQL, Tarea de SQL Preparación, para incluir una definición de la columna FullName en la tabla Query. En esta tarea, modificará el destino de OLE DB, Destination - Query, para que admita la columna FullName.

También restaurará las asignaciones de columnas en Destination - Query que ya no son válidas porque ha agregado una transformación Ordenar al flujo de datos. La transformación Ordenar genera un nuevo conjunto de columnas con diferentes identificadores y, por tanto, es necesario volver a asignar las columnas de entrada y de destino en Destination - Query.

Para modificar el destino de OLE DB

  1. Si todavía no está abierto, abra el diseñador de Flujo de datos haciendo doble clic en Tarea Flujo de datos o haciendo clic en la ficha Flujo de datos.

  2. Haga clic en la transformación Columna derivada denominada Add FullName Column y arrastre su flecha verde a Destination - Query.

  3. Haga doble clic en Destination - Query.

  4. En el cuadro de diálogo Restaurar el editor de referencias de columna no válidas, haga clic en Seleccionar todo, seleccione la opción <Asignar con nombre de columna> en la lista Opción de asignación de columnas para las filas seleccionadas y, a continuación, haga clic en Aplicar.

    Puede desactivar la casilla de verificación Incluir referencias de columna no válidas de nivel inferior. En este paquete, no existen componentes del flujo de datos de nivel inferior y esta opción no tiene ningún efecto.

  5. Haga clic en Aceptar.

  6. Haga clic con el botón secundario en Destination -Query y haga clic en Mostrar editor avanzado.

  7. En el cuadro de diálogo Editor avanzado, haga clic en Propiedades de entrada y salida, expanda Entrada de destino, haga clic en Columnas externas y, a continuación, haga clic en Agregar columna.

    Se agrega una nueva columna con el nombre Columna a la carpeta Columnas externas.

  8. Haga clic en la nueva columna.

  9. En el panel derecho, actualice la propiedad Name a FullName, haga clic en la propiedad DataType y seleccione Cadena Unicode [DT_WSTR] en la lista. Actualice la propiedad Length a 103.

  10. Haga clic en la ficha Asignaciones de columnas y desplácese hasta la fila con FullName en la lista Columna de destino. Haga clic en <omitir> en la lista Columna de entradade esa fila y, a continuación, haga clic en FullName en la lista.

  11. Compruebe que todas las columnas de entrada y salida que tienen los mismos nombres están asignadas.

  12. Haga clic en Aceptar.

Siguiente tarea de la lección

Tarea 6: Probar el paquete básico de la lección 2

Icono de Integration Services (pequeño) Manténgase al día con Integration Services

Para obtener las más recientes descargas, artículos, ejemplos y vídeos de Microsoft, así como soluciones seleccionadas de la comunidad, visite la página de Integration Services en MSDN o TechNet:

Para recibir notificaciones automáticas de estas actualizaciones, suscríbase a las fuentes RSS disponibles en la página.

Vea también

Conceptos